Anchor Text for Article Writing
Hello,
I have been writing articles for submission to directories to obtain backlinks for my sites, but I have a question. How do I put anchor text for my link in the resource box instead of just writing out my website address? I understand that having this anchor text helps in SEO. Thanks for any help. |

Re: Anchor Text for Article Writing
Some sites you have to pay to use anchor text. I think this is more true for press releases than articles though.
Some article sites let you use html. If so put this where you want the link: [ QUOTE ] <a href="http://www.buttsexorwhatever.com">This is anchor text</a> [/ QUOTE ] |
